2017-04-21 92 views
-3

因此,我在Laravel Passport和Axios上使用laravel處理API調用的瀏覽器上構建了一種消息傳遞服務。Ajax Axios Javascript messenger的最佳實踐

我在想什麼是瀏覽器使用盡可能少的數據從服務器接收數據的最佳方式。我所能想到的是每隔數秒鐘就要求數據。

我想知道是否有人有如何有效地獲取數據的例子或說明。

我目前沒有使用vue js,因爲我想讓所有的東西都用jQuery來代替。

+0

什麼是有效的...你問意見了...... – VikingCode

+0

確定有效maynot是我一直在說的最好辦法。我正在尋找一種不斷連接到數據庫的方式,並且幾乎可以立即獲得我需要的數據,就像facebook messenger在瀏覽器中所做的那樣,或者在獲取新的推文時無需重載用戶數據/帶寬。 @VikingCode –

回答

0

你在找什麼是'事件驅動的推送消息'。

鏈接,讓你開始

  • Socket.IO實現實時雙向的基於事件的通信。 - socket.io

  • 的實現tutorial(walktrough)爲LaravelSocket.IO